Difference to Bates Method

What is the difference between Unleash Your Vision and the Bates Method?

The difference between the Unleash Your Vision, and the Bates Method, Rebuild Your Vision, & the See Clearly Method is that Unleash Your Vision is a holistic approach to healing the eyes. The Bates method and its eye exercises merely treat the symptoms of eye conditions, but not the cause.

Unleash Your Vision first addresses the cause of the eye conditions and afterward focuses on eliminating the symptoms, so that the healing is long-term and doesn’t diminish over time because the same cause brings about the same condition again.

With its holistic approach, Unleash Your Vision takes the whole bodily system into consideration, which also increases your blood circulation, strengthens your immune and nervous systems, and in combination with the dietary advice contained in Unleash Your Vision you will become healthier overall.

Further, the Bates method only works on the muscles around the eyes, whereby the Unleash Your Vision course deals with the mind-set first, then gets the body in better shape through the whole body gymnastics, and lastly works with the eye muscles in the Eye-Lympix, a set of eye exercises that are similar to Bates’ eye exercises.

Lastly, many people report that they get headaches from the Bates method, which doesn’t occur with Unleash Your Vision because you get the necessary dietary advice to avoid these headaches as well.
